On Tue, Mar 15, 2005 at 02:40:37PM -0700, Waldemar Osuch wrote: > Recently I have set up my machine for compiling pytables on WindowsXP > with Python-2.4. > [...] > building 'tables.hdf5Extension' extension > C:\Program Files\Microsoft Visual Studio .NET 2003\Vc7\bin\cl.exe /c /nologo /Ox > /MD /W3 /GX /DNDEBUG -DWIN32=1 -DNDEBUG=1 -D_HDF5USEDLL_=1 -Ic:\gnu\src\hdf5\in > clude -Ic:\python\python24\include -Ic:\python\python24\PC /Tcsrc/typeconv.c /Fo > build\temp.win32-2.4\Release\src/typeconv.obj > typeconv.c > src\typeconv.c(45) : error C2036: 'void *' : unknown size > src\typeconv.c(51) : warning C4013: 'lround' undefined; assuming > extern returning int > src\typeconv.c(62) : error C2036: 'void *' : unknown size > error: command '"C:\Program Files\Microsoft Visual Studio .NET > 2003\Vc7\bin\cl.exe"' failed with exit status 2 > > I completely understand that pytables-latest is just a development > version and it can fail. > The only purpose of this email is to indicate that there is a potential problem. Thanks a lot for your mail. The pointer problems seem to be related with the strange way MSVC has to do pointer arithmetic. The missing 'lround' function is part of the C99 standard, which is not supported by MSVC. I have attached a simple patch which makes pointer arithmetic in the MS way and defines an 'lround' function if C99 is not supported. Could you please apply it to src/typeconv.c and check whether it works? I am also interested in checking that tests/test_timetype.py works right.
